About the role

We are partnering with a leading European multinational with a strong and growing presence across Asia Pacific to hire a commercially driven and tech-savvy FP&A professional to support regional business performance, financial planning and decision-making across multiple APAC markets. This is an excellent opportunity for candidates who enjoy working with data, business partnering and regional exposure within a dynamic multinational environment.

Responsibilities

  • Support regional budgeting, forecasting and management reporting processes across APAC
  • To assist and support financial mid-term planning, annual budgeting and regular forecasting processes, consolidation, and reporting requirements
  • Analyse trends, variances and operational KPIs to support business performance management
  • Assist in business units reporting for the region, including but not limited to profitability by markets, sales reporting, margin variance analysis and sales pipeline assessments
  • To assist in monitoring and analyzing key metrics, drive operational performance, support cost optimization and efficiency
  • Prepare and enhance KPI dashboards and management reports
  • Support reporting automation and data transparency initiatives using BI and digital tools
  • Participate in regional projects and ad-hoc financial analysis

Requirements

  • Degree in Accountancy, Finance or equivalent professional qualification
  • Approximately 4-6 years of relevant FP&A, commercial finance or business controlling experience within MNCs
  • Strong analytical and business insight capabilities with the ability to interpret financial variances, trends and anomalies across regional markets and business units
  • Strong financial planning and forecasting discipline with high ownership of regional reporting and planning processes
  • Structured thinker with strong problem-solving skills and the ability to prioritize effectively in a fast-paced, multi-country and matrix environment
  • Strong stakeholder management and communication skills with the ability to partner effectively across functions, cultures and regional teams
  • Tech-savvy and comfortable working with large datasets, reporting automation and BI tools to drive data transparency and business insights
  • Advanced Excel skills with exposure to BI tools and dashboard reporting
  • Experience with SAP and AI-enabled reporting tools will be advantageous
  • Hands-on, detail-oriented and commercially minded with a proactive and collaborative working style
